Wisconsin can get a huge tournament boost Sunday if we beat Michigan.

Right now, the Badgers are 15-6, and we’re in an okay tournament position, but we’re far from being a top seed, which is what fans have been expecting. (RELATED: David Hookstead Is The True King In The North When It Comes To College Football)

The rematch against the Wolverines provides a huge opportunity for us to jump seed positioning.
